Building a wallpaper platform is not only about creating images. Sometimes, it’s about stepping back and improving the foundation.

Today was one of those days.

Instead of generating new collections, I focused on refining Monoframe itself. Over the past few weeks, the platform has grown significantly, with new premium collections, journal entries, and an expanding wallpaper library. As the content grew, I realized the experience needed to become simpler and more organized.

One of the biggest decisions today was simplifying the structure of the gallery. Rather than separating content across multiple concepts and pages, I focused on creating a cleaner browsing experience that allows visitors to quickly find what they’re looking for.

The mobile experience also received several improvements. Since a large portion of visitors discover wallpapers through social media platforms like Pinterest, ensuring a smooth experience on phones is just as important as the desktop version. Layout adjustments, navigation improvements, and collection visibility were all carefully reviewed.

Premium Collections were another major focus. New collection pages now provide clearer presentation, pricing visibility, and easier access to Gumroad downloads. The goal is to make each collection feel more like a finished product rather than a simple download page.

I also spent time reviewing the site’s SEO structure. The sitemap, robots configuration, article indexing, and collection pages were checked to ensure that search engines can properly discover and understand the growing content library.
